Intermittent pneumatic devices are a type of equipment that may assist people in recovering from certain medical conditions. Air pressure is employed in these devices to  squeeze and release parts of  the body, typically the legs. This can help the blood flow and might  reduce swelling. They are frequently employed after surgery or for ailments, such as lymphedema, where fluid accumulates in the body. The merits of these devices render them a useful addition to patient care. Intermittent pneumatic devices, or IPDs, are machines that  help people who have difficulty with  their blood flow, as when recovering from surgery  or sitting still for extended periods of time. And using them  properly can affect how well they work. To  begin  with, read the instructions that come  with your KONBEST device. These  instructions will teach you how to  set it up and use it  safely. Don’t forget to clean the  gadget every now and then. This keeps it  safe and makes it work better. When you slip the device on, tighten  it to fit firmly but  not too snugly. If  it’s too tight, it can hurt, and if it’s too loose, it won’t be as effective. Then, operate  the apparatus at the proper  time. The average  person should use it for  half an hour to an hour several times a day. This can help prevent blood from  pooling and avoid problems like swelling.
